Chemonics seeks a national technical manager for USAID's ongoing Famine Early Warnings Systems Network (FEWS NET) project. FEWS NET maintains offices in a number of countries in Africa, Central America, Central Asia, and Haiti. The national technical manager (NTM) serves as the technical and administrative head of each country office. Where appropriate, the NTM will also support remote monitoring in selected countries. The NTM will oversee quality control for project deliverables and ensure that activities and products are delivered in a timely manner. This position is based in Antananarivo, Madagascar.
